HR Generalist
**HR Generalist** **Location: Waterford/Shelby/Westland, MI** **Salary: $25 - $30 an hour** **Schedule: Part-Time 30 hours** **Position Overview:** ? Kelly Services has partnered with a global leader in the fastening industry since its founding in 1942. As part of their team in the automotive sector, we are looking for a dynamic HR Generalist to join them. This dual-role position combines strategic partnership with business leaders and hands-on HR operations, making it a vital part of the organization’s success. **Responsibilities:** ? + Act as a trusted advisor to business leaders, understanding business goals and aligning HR strategies to support overall organizational success. + Serve as a point of contact for employees, addressing concerns and resolving workplace issues to ensure a positive and productive work environment. + Oversee the performance appraisal process, coach managers on giving feedback, and ensure that individual and team performance aligns with organizational goals. + Support recruitment efforts by partnering with internal Talent Acquisition team. + Facilitate smooth onboarding for new hires, ensuring they integrate well into the company culture. + Ensure company policies are compliant with legal regulations and industry best practices. + Educate employees and managers on HR policies and procedures. + Identify skill gaps and recommend training programs to enhance employee development and engagement. + Support compensation strategy and ensure that benefits programs are communicated effectively and understood by employees. + Collect and analyze HR data to provide insights on workforce trends and recommend improvements in HR practices. **Qualifications and Requirements:** ? +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or related field. + 3 years of experience in HR, with a blend of HR Business Partnering and Generalist roles. + Strong knowledge of employment law, HR policies, and best practices. + Excellent communication, problem-solving, and interpersonal skills. +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ment. + Proficiency with HRIS systems and Microsoft Office. **Next Steps** ?
